Facilities Connectivity under the Belt and Road Initiative
Facilities connectivity is a central pillar of the Belt and Road Initiative (BRI), serving as the physical foundation for economic integration, trade expansion, and regional development. By improving infrastructure networks across participating countries, facilities connectivity enhances the flow of goods, capital, technology, and people, thereby supporting inclusive and sustainable growth.
1. Transport Infrastructure Connectivity
Transport infrastructure is the core component of facilities connectivity. The Belt and Road Initiative prioritizes the construction and upgrading of railways, highways, ports, airports, and logistics hubs to improve cross-border and interregional mobility. Flagship projects such as international railway corridors and port cooperation networks help reduce transportation costs, shorten delivery times, and increase the efficiency of global and regional supply chains.
2. Energy Infrastructure Connectivity
Energy connectivity plays a vital role in supporting economic development and energy security. Under the BRI framework, cooperation focuses on cross-border power grids, oil and gas pipelines, renewable energy facilities, and energy storage systems. Increasing attention is given to clean and low-carbon energy projects, including solar, wind, and hydropower, contributing to both economic growth and climate objectives.
3. Digital Infrastructure Connectivity
Digital facilities connectivity has become an emerging priority of the Belt and Road Initiative. Investment in broadband networks, fiber-optic cables, data centers, and satellite systems strengthens digital links among participating countries. Digital infrastructure enables the development of e-commerce, smart logistics, digital finance, and cross-border data services, helping partner countries participate more fully in the global digital economy.
4. Industrial and Logistics Facilities
The development of industrial parks, special economic zones, and logistics centers is an important aspect of facilities connectivity. These platforms support manufacturing cooperation, technology transfer, and value-chain integration. By combining infrastructure development with industrial capacity building, BRI facilities connectivity promotes local employment, skills development, and economic diversification.
5. Green and Sustainable Infrastructure
Sustainability is increasingly emphasized in facilities connectivity. The Belt and Road Initiative promotes green infrastructure standards, environmentally friendly construction methods, and climate-resilient facilities. Incorporating environmental impact assessments and sustainability principles helps ensure that infrastructure projects deliver long-term benefits while minimizing ecological risks.
6. Standards, Safety, and Maintenance Cooperation
Beyond construction, facilities connectivity requires effective standards alignment, safety management, and long-term maintenance. Cooperation in technical standards, engineering norms, and operational management enhances interoperability across borders. Capacity-building initiatives help partner countries strengthen infrastructure governance and operational efficiency.
